CMC (Carboxymethyl Cellulose)

CMC (Carboxymethyl Cellulose)

CMC is an anionic water-soluble polymer derived from cellulose. It is used as a thickener, stabilizer, and moisture retainer.

Molecular Wt:
Variable (typically 90,000–700,000)
Melting Pt:
Decomposes
Appearance:
White or light yellow powder.
Application:
Mortar and Adhesives: Enhances water retention and workability.

Food: Stabilizer and thickener.

Cosmetics: Binder and emulsion stabilizer.
